Transaction 0101756c206da484bd8c6924790582aee02821700f1f80a1d2bb84f19b987386

1 Input
2 Outputs
  • 0101756c206da484bd8c6924790582aee02821700f1f80a1d2bb84f19b987386:0
  • value  7755750
    address  3ESkMC4CQPi2oSbyW3hDhsXR7MuEDJ6RkB
  • 0101756c206da484bd8c6924790582aee02821700f1f80a1d2bb84f19b987386:1
  • value  41633108
    address  13RqSfkk17hgUc89hRNtfJqTJ9H5nsZWwc